Evolution of Athletic Broadcasting


The development of sports broadcasting began in the early 20th century with radio as the main medium for transmitting live athletic events to viewers. The primary major sports broadcast occurred in the year 1921 when a fight between Dunne and McGurn was aired. This event marked a crucial moment in the history of sports, as it allowed spectators to interact with their favorite athletic activities without being physically present at the location. As audio broadcasting gained notoriety, athletic reporting expanded, leading to a growing need for more comprehensive reporting and commentary.


With the advent of TV in the fifties, sports broadcasting experienced a significant shift. Televised athletic events grasped the attention of millions, significantly increasing viewership. Memorable events, such as the initial telecast of the NFL Championship in the year 1958, showcased the power of TV to enrich the experience of sports. Broadcasters began to integrate new technologies, such as instant replay and varied camera perspectives, further enriching the audience’s engagement and comprehension of the sport. This era marked the initiation of athletic organizations and associations recognizing the importance of alliances with media to expand their audience and brand.


The growth of the internet in the late 1990s and early 2000s era brought yet another transformation in athletic broadcasting. Streaming platforms and online platforms provided viewers with extraordinary access to real-time matches, recaps, and updates. This transition not only made athletic events more accessible but also created new opportunities for creators and influencers to engage with audiences. Social media emerged as a powerful resource for sports broadcasting, allowing for immediate news, engagement, and the sharing of highlights, fundamentally changing how fans consumed athletic events and interacted with teams, athletes, and each other.

Regulatory Hurdles


The landscape of sports broadcast is increasingly difficult by a multitude of regulations imposed by governing bodies and entities. Broadcasters must navigate complex licensing agreements that dictate which content can be shown, the manner in which it can be distributed, and the associated royalty payments. These regulations often differ from locale to locale, complicating the ability to deliver a uniform product to audiences globally.


In addition to licensing, compliance with broadcasting standards poses a major challenge. This includes restrictions on advertising, language, and content that protects minors and upholds decency standards. Broadcasters must be alert and flexible to stay within these legal frameworks while still connecting with their audience adequately. Failing to comply can result in large monetary fines and damage to public image, complicating further the competitive landscape.


Intellectual property rights also present a key hurdle for sports broadcasters. With the rise of online platforms and social media, protecting content from illegal use has become paramount. Broadcasters must enforce stringent measures to safeguard their broadcasts while also identifying new revenue streams through digital content. This juggling act is vital, as any misstep can lead to major losses both economically and in audience trust.
